I found a dozen or so eggs sitting in the filter and they hatched out in the last day or so. With the fish in the tank that they are in, I don't think they will be very safe with the parents.

What I'm interested in knowing is... what would be the best thing to feed them after the yolk sac is gone? I have very fine fry food.. would that do as a starter? I'm also thinking of putting them into an established cherry shrimp tank.. I assume in the short term the shrimp wouldn't bother them.. Would they be okay in there for a few months until they got to a size they might harass the shrimp?

I used to raise BN kids in a tank w. Cherry Shrimp, they'll be fine together indefinitely. I feed BN babies the same as adults. NLS sinking wafers, NLS Grow and zuccinni.
